What can we do?

We need to plant the love of nature in him in the best way possible. It is very easy to raise his awareness and engage him in the game with small tasks.
Most of us have to raise our children in big cities, far away from nature and green spaces. I would like to support you in getting them into the game with a few small suggestions.

Let's Look to the Sky
The sky is one of the most beautiful ways to connect with the cosmic universe in which the child lives.
For him, it is a whole universe where he encounters light, air, rain and birds. Looking at the sky is hope, freedom and light for children, as it is for all of us.
It is also a wonderful window into imagination.
Noticing the wind, pointing to the stars, greeting the birds are signs of the beautiful bonds they have established.
You can look at the sky together, write stories with the clouds and leave it to imagination.

Awareness of nature and living things
Everywhere I see activities like cutting branches and picking flowers. What we say and what we do should be one, so that we become leaders that our children will follow with admiration. We can teach them to love flowers without plucking them, then we will make them realize that they are also living beings. By teaching them what we need most these days, to respect every living thing and its right to life, we can support them to grow up as individuals with self-respect.
When our children see a flower, even in the concrete of their apartments, they are excited to go and pet and smell it. Planting a tiny flower together is sometimes an unforgettable memory for the child.

For example, when they learn that every time they run the faucet unnecessarily, this water is also water for the fish, that we share it and that they will be sad if we use too much, their perspective on water use starts to change.
And of course, another good example is garbage. When they see garbage on the ground and you pick it up and throw it in the trash can, it becomes a wonderful mark for them for a lifetime.
Great celebrations are possible without plastic.
Fabric, wool and paper can be used to make ornaments for every celebration. You can even keep them and leave them with a lasting memory.
You will realize how good natural materials are for your child. When the celebration box comes out, he will know that a wonderful day is coming, and if you explain that he is serving nature and the life of other living beings, his life will be filled with purpose and joy.
You can put the money you would have spent on harmful ornaments into a fund and use it for nature support projects where you can spend time together.
You can go to feed animals and support stray animals.
